
Empowering surgeons to focus on what they do best
The powerhouse sitting behind Grace Orthopaedic Centre is Orthopaedic Services Limited (OSL). OSL is the management and coordination team, consolidating contract management, shared systems, infrastructure, and centre management so the member surgeons can focus on their patients while OSL ensures everything else is taken care of.
Trusted Partner to ACC, Health NZ, and the Public System
OSL blends private-sector agility with public-sector accountability, partnering with ACC, Health New Zealand | Te Whatu Ora, and other funders to deliver clinical and surgical care at scale.
This ensures patients receive timely, high-quality orthopaedic care - while funders connect with a single, trusted partner focused on delivering high-quality outcomes, faster access to care, and unparalleled community impact.

OSL & Grace Orthopaedic Centre
Grace Orthopaedic Centre was purpose-built by the OSL surgeons when Grace Hospital was being developed. While Grace Hospital now owns the building, OSL has leased the space ever since and continues to manage the facility.
We sublet the rooms to surgeons—most of whom also work under OSL’s surgical contracts with ACC and other funders—and take care of anything that impacts how the centre operates. While each surgeon runs their own practice and employs their own team, OSL provides shared systems, infrastructure, and leadership on anything that affects multiple practices.
It’s a setup that allows surgeons to stay focused on their patients while we take care of everything from facility policies to being the central point for things like privacy compliance.
How it Works
In most cases, a patient is referred to a surgeon through ACC or identified by the public hospital as a candidate for outsourced surgery. That initial consultation is billed through OSL under our Clinical Services contract.
If surgery is needed, the surgeon and their practice put together an Assessment and Treatment Plan (ARTP), which OSL submits to ACC for approval. Once it’s signed off, the practice coordinates the surgery at Grace Hospital.
From there, OSL handles the behind-the-scenes work—processing payments from the funder and distributing them to the hospital, anaesthetist, and surgeon.
